EXHIBITION AND CATALOG ON SOUTHEAST ASIAN ART

"LIFE, DEATH, & MAGIC:
2000 Years of Southeast Asian Ancestral Art."
By Robyn Maxwell.

Catalog for the current exhibition at the National Gallery of Australia.  This important exhibition runs from August 13 to October 31, 2010.

NEW DISCOVERY OF OLDEST HUMAN IN THE PHILIPPINES

"CALLAO MAN Could Redraw Filipino History:
A foot bone from a human that lived 67,000 years ago suggests that settlers first arrived earlier than once thought."

The discovery suggests that raft- or boat-building crafts would have been around at that time.
